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ues beneath a building’s main level that compromise structural integrity and safety. These services typically involve inspecting the crawlspace area to identify problems such as sagging or uneven floors, moisture intrusion, mold growth, or pest infestations. Repair methods may include installing or replacing support beams, joists, or piers, as well as sealing gaps and improving ventilation to prevent future issues. The goal is to stabilize the foundation and create a healthier environment underneath the property.
Many problems that crawlspace repair services help resolve stem from moisture buildup and poor drainage, which can lead to wood rot, mold development, and pest attraction. Over time, these issues may cause floors to become uneven, create unpleasant odors, or reduce the overall stability of the structure. Addressing these concerns early can prevent more extensive and costly repairs down the line. The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Baraboo,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Repair Cost - The typical cost range for crawlspace foundation repairs varies from $1,500 to $7,000, depending on the extent of work needed. For example, minor repairs may cost around $1,500, while extensive underpinning could reach $7,000 or more.
Repair Methods - Different repair methods influence costs, with pier and beam reinforcement averaging between $2,000 and $5,000. More complex solutions like full foundation stabilization can exceed $10,000 in some cases.
Material Expenses - Material costs for crawlspace repairs generally range from $500 to $2,500, covering supports, piers, and moisture barriers. The choice of materials impacts overall expenses significantly.
Location Factors - Costs may vary based on local market conditions and the specific location, such as Baraboo, WI, where typical repair prices align with regional averages. Variations depend on accessibility and soil conditions in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ven flooring, visible cracks in walls or floors, musty odors, and increased pest activity in the home.
How do professionals typically repair crawlspace foundations? Repairs often involve underpinning, installing support piers, or sealing and insulating the crawlspace to stabilize the foundation.
Is crawlspace foundation repair necessary for every issue? Not all problems require repair; a professional assessment can determine if repairs are needed to prevent further damage.
What factors influence the cost of crawlspace foundation repair? Costs vary based on the extent of damage, repair methods used, and local labor rates in Baraboo and nearby areas.
How can homeowners prevent future crawlspace foundation problems? Regular inspections, proper drainage, and maintaining moisture levels can help reduce the risk of foundation issues.
